hello i was wondering what whiteline suspension package (sports or handling) is best to start off with on a stock sprinter? which pack makes the most difference and which will cut out the 'doughie' feeling of my stock AE86? is the works worth the $2500? or is it a better idea to get the handling pack then get some 2nd hand coilovers and springs?

if your hellbent on whiteline

get the works kit
plus all the extras

set you back a penny but its worth it

AND

id go with fully adjustable front coilovers and TRD springs (5-7kg/mm for road use)
with rear bilstein shocks and 4-5kg/mm springs (TRD also if you can)
